WebFind individual and classroom assessments from Pearson for clinical psychology, education, speech language pathology, occupational therapy, early childhood and more. ... to a full suite of training and support — we … WebA psychometrist is responsible for the administration and scoring of psychological and neuropsychological tests under the supervision of a clinical psychologist or clinical neuropsychologist. Psychometrist training should have emphasis on accuracy, validity, and standardization in administration.
